Choosing the Right Lock for Your Home
When selecting a lock for your home, it's essential to consider factors such as security level, ease of use, and compatibility with your existing doors. Different types of locks, including deadbolts, smart locks, and knob locks, offer varying degrees of protection and convenience.
For instance, deadbolts are known for their robust security features, making them ideal for exterior doors. On the other hand, smart locks provide keyless entry and can be controlled remotely, adding an extra layer of convenience for modern homeowners.
Understanding Different Types of Keys and Their Functions
Keys come in various types, each designed for specific locks and purposes. Understanding these differences can help homeowners and vehicle owners choose the right key for their needs, whether it's a traditional metal key or a modern electronic key fob.
For example, transponder keys contain a chip that communicates with the vehicle's ignition system, providing enhanced security against theft. Similarly, master keys are designed to operate multiple locks, making them useful for businesses and property managers.
Tips for Improving Home Security on a Budget
Improving home security doesn't have to be expensive. There are several cost-effective measures that homeowners can take to enhance their safety without breaking the bank. Simple changes, such as installing security cameras or motion-sensor lights, can significantly deter potential intruders.
Additionally, reinforcing doors and windows with security film or adding deadbolts can provide extra peace of mind. These small investments can lead to a more secure home environment while staying within a budget.
The Importance of Regular Lock Maintenance
Regular maintenance of locks is crucial for ensuring their functionality and longevity. Neglecting this aspect can lead to issues such as locks becoming stiff, keys not turning smoothly, or even complete lock failure in critical situations.
Routine checks, including lubricating locks and inspecting for wear and tear, can prevent these problems. Homeowners should also consider having a professional locksmith evaluate their locks periodically to ensure optimal performance and security.
